The average lifespan for back Dermals piercing lasts about 6 months-2 years depending on how well you take care of them and what you do to them during that time. Micro dermal piercings can last up to 8 years as some poeple said. Dermal pierce removal requires a professional to do the job. The removal requires two surgical tools, which are the forceps and the scalpel. The piercing site is sterilized before removal with the use of antiseptic and surgical scrub. The skin surrounding the anchor site is incised with the use of a scalpel. The anchor is pulled out of the skin ...

There is no medical reason to favor one nostril over...Jan 1, 2024 · Aftercare and Healing. After getting a dermal back dimple piercing, the aftercare regimen is vital. You’ll need to clean the area regularly with saline solution and avoid any unnecessary pressure or friction. Healing times can vary, but generally, it takes about 2-3 months for the piercing to settle in. Patience and diligent care are your ...

A Typical Neck Piercing. When you get pierced your brain knows you want the piercing, but it takes your body a little longer to get on the same page. Your body’s immediate reaction is to treat the piercing as an open wound - because technically, it is. Normally, with proper aftercare, your body heals and adapts to the piercing. Dermal piercings are prone to migration or rejection because they cannot penetrate deep into the skin. Rejection can also happen when your body cells react to the piercing by pushing it out. The skin tissues recognize the piercing as a foreign object and avoid it. Ear piercing is a popular form of body modification that has been practiced for centuries.
